Abstract
An image receiving sheet for thermal transfer recording, which comprises a substrate and an image receiving layer formed thereon for receiving a sublimable dye, wherein the image receiving layer comprises, as the main component, a product formed by thermosetting a composition comprising an active hydrogen-containing resin, a silicone resin, a silicone oil and a polyfunctional isocyanate compound.
